Larry L. Leatherwood

It is with deep sadness that the Board of Directors of Uplift Our Youth Foundation announces the passing of our beloved founder, Larry L. Leatherwood.

Larry founded Uplift Our Youth Foundation in 2002 with the vision of creating an organization that provides resources to support the growth and development of Lansing area youth. His unwavering dedication and passion to give young people an opportunity to learn life skills and fulfill their potential have shaped this organization and touched countless lives.

“For over 20 years, Larry, through his leadership and standing in the community, inspired people to support his vision.” said Myron Frierson, Chairman of the Board, “His legacy will forever be the guiding force behind our mission, and we are committed to continuing this vital work.”

The Board extends its deepest sympathies to Larry’s wife, Martha, son, Jeff and daughter, Staci.

Larry will be greatly missed by the board and the individuals and communities we serve.

Jason Blanks

With profound sadness, the Uplift Our Youth Foundation announces the passing of our board colleague and friend, Jason Blanks. We extend our deepest sympathy to his wife, children, family, and to all those who knew and loved him. Jason’s loss is deeply felt across our Foundation and throughout the Lansing community he served so faithfully.

Jason joined the Uplift Our Youth Foundation as a member of our Executive Committee, where he brought not only his leadership and experience, but a genuine belief in the potential of every young person. He was a consistent voice for equity, compassion, and opportunity. His service to the Foundation reflected who he was—steady, thoughtful, and deeply committed to helping others rise.

Jason’s dedication to community was also evident throughout his professional work. As Executive Director of the Capital Area Health Alliance, he provided strategic direction that strengthened partnerships across healthcare systems, government, education, and nonprofit organizations. His work centered on improving health outcomes and addressing the social factors—housing, access to care, safety, and community support—that shape the futures of children and families. Jason believed that when we care for the whole person, we strengthen the entire community.

On his professional profile, Jason described himself as someone who connects organizations to the resources they need to function and thrive. In practice, this meant he was a bridge-builder—someone who could bring leaders together, align them around a shared purpose, and ensure that meaningful change followed. At UOYF, he applied that same collaborative approach to helping us expand our reach and deepen our impact across Clinton, Eaton, and Ingham counties.

But beyond titles and roles, Jason was profoundly human. He was the person who asked how you were—and waited for the real answer. He led with warmth. He listened without ego. He encouraged others quietly and consistently. He believed in excellence, but also in grace.
